Brief Summary

The investigators believe that the oxygen supply to the heart can be compromised around the time of surgery in ISH patients Chemicals known as stress hormones are secreted around the time of surgery, increasing oxygen needs in the heart and may make the oxygen supply to the heart muscle critical (know as myocardial ischemia). This in turn may result in a heart attack and death. Studies have shown that patients with myocardial ischemia stand a 9-fold increase in odds ratio of suffering a heart attack, worsening of angina, or death.
This study aims to compare the incidence of myocardial ischemia in patients with ISH and normal BP patients around the time of surgery using a special heart monitor. In addition, the study aims to determine the prevalence of ISH among surgical patients and to document complications like heart attacks, heart failure, stroke and death after surgery.
This research project will be conducted at the Ottawa Hospital by a multi-disciplinary research group (perioperative research group)which includes anesthesiology, cardiology, general surgery and epidemiology. The research group secured HSFO funding for this study.
Detailed Description

This is the first study looking exclusively at ISH as a risk factor around the time of surgery. Studies suggest that investigators may be labelling surgical patients at risk of a heart attack as "low risk" when in fact the bulk of those heart attacks are in patients labeled "low risk". The finding that ISH patients have a higher incidence of myocardial ischemia will provide evidence for the next level of research. If ISH is in fact a risk factor for heart attacks around the time of surgery, the investigators will identify a group of patients in whom the investigators can lower this risk by instituting appropriate management.

ISH and normotensive
This is a prospective cohort study to compare the incidence of perioperative myocardial ischemia between ISH and normotensive patients admitted for elective non-cardiac surgery. To reduce the number of confounding factors for perioperative myocardial ischemia, RCRI Class I or II patients will be recruited.

Eligibility Criteria

Inclusion Criteria
* ISH or normotensive (as per Patient Recruitment and Informed Consent section)
* Elective non cardiac surgical procedure
* Expected to stay in hospital ≥ 48 hours
* Revised cardiac risk index (RCRI) ≤ 251
Exclusion Criteria
* Left bundle branch block (LBBB)
* Myocardial infarction \< 3 months
* Decompensated congestive heart failure
* Unstable coronary syndrome
* Dialysis
* Emergency surgery
